one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a way on the net during which a protracted URL can be converted into a shorter, additional workable type. This shortened URL redirects to the first long URL when frequented. Services like Bitly and TinyURL are well-recognized examples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the appearance of social media marketing platforms like Twitter, in which character limitations for posts manufactured it hard to share prolonged URLs.

Further than social media, URL shorteners are handy in advertising campaigns, email messages, and printed media the place lengthy URLs is often cumbersome.

2. Core Factors of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ener typically contains the subsequent factors:

World wide web Interface: Here is the front-conclude aspect wherever buyers can enter their extensive URLs and receive shortened versions. It might be a simple type on the web page.
Database: A databases is essential to retail store the mapping amongst the initial long URL and also the shortened version.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L options like MongoDB can be utilized.
Redirection Logic: This is the backend logic that normally takes the small URL and redirects the person to your corresponding very long URL. This logic will likely be carried out in the internet server or an software layer.
API: A lot of URL shorteners offer an API to ensure third-social gathering ap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first prolonged URLs.
3. Coming up with the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a long URL into a brief a person. Several techniques may be employed, which include:

Hashing: The very long URL could be hashed into a fixed-measurement string, which serves as the limited URL. Even so, hash collisions (diverse URLs resulting in the exact same h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: A person widespread approach is to utilize Base62 encoding (which works by using 62 characters: 0-nine, A-Z, and a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ry while in the databases. This technique makes certain that the short URL is as limited as you possibly can.
Random String Technology: One more solution would be to generate a random string of a hard and fast length (e.g., six figures) and Verify if it’s presently in use inside the databases. Otherwise, it’s assigned towards the extended URL.
4. Database Management
The database schema for the URL shortener will likely be straightforward, with two Major fields:

ID: A unique identifier for every URL entry.
Lengthy URL: The initial URL that needs to be shortened.
Shorter URL/Slug: The shorter Model from the URL, usually saved as a unique string.
Together with these, it is advisable to retail store metadata such as the generation day, expiration day, and the number of periods the short URL continues to be accessed.

five.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ection is really a important Element of the URL shortener's operation. Each time a user clicks on a short URL, the services really should speedily retrieve the initial URL from the databases and redirect the consumer utilizing an HTTP 301 (everlasting redirect) or 302 (momentary redirect) position code.

Efficiency is key in this article, as the method need to be virtually instantaneous. Methods like databases indexing and caching (e.g., using Redis or Memcached) is often used to speed up the retrieval course of action.

6. Protection Criteria
Safety is a big issue in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ener might be abused to distribute destructive hyperlinks. Applying UR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-occasion protection expert services to examine URLs prior to shortening them can mitigate this possibility.
Spam Avoidance: Price limiting and CAPTCHA can protect against abuse by spammers trying to crank out Countless small URLs.
seven. Scalability
Since the URL shortener grows, it might require to take care of millions of UR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, probably invol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ted traffic throughout a number of servers to manage substantial masses.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Independent considerations like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into various providers to impro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ners normally deliver anal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, exactly where the visitors is coming from, along with other helpful metrics. This requires logging each redirect And perhaps integrating with analytics platforms.

nine. Summary
Building a URL shortener requires a blend of frontend and backend enhancement, databases management, and a spotlight to protection and scalability. Though it might seem like a straightforward provider, creating a strong, productive, and secure URL shortener offers various troubles and calls for cautious scheduling and execution. Irrespective of whether you’re producing it for private use, inner enterprise resources, or to be a community assistance, knowing the fundamental principles and finest practices is essential for achievements.
